Palmyra Hotels with Outdoor or Indoor Pools

Super 8 by Wyndham Hannibal : 120 Huckleberry Heights Dr.
+1-888-389-4121
120 Huckleberry Heights Dr., Hannibal, MO 63401 +1-888-389-4121 ~9.80 miles southeast of Palmyra
  • Pool details: Outdoors - Seasonal(May - September) - 9:00 AM to 9:00 PM
  • Cheap Highway property
From$60
Average 3.0 /5 Recent Reviews Call BookMore Details
Best Western On the River : 401 North 3rd St.
+1-888-675-2083
401 North 3rd St., Hannibal, MO 63401 +1-888-675-2083 ~10.48 miles southeast of Palmyra
  • Pool details: Both of our pools indoor and outdoor are open from 9:00 am to 9:00 pm, unless there is inclement weather and or lightening. We also have an indoor hot tub that is open 9:00 am to 9:00 pm
  • 2-star Downtown property
From$91
Very Good 4.0 /5 Hotel Reviews Call BookMore Details
Fairfield Inn & Suites Quincy in Quincy
+1-800-716-8490
4415 Broadway St., Quincy, IL 62305 +1-800-716-8490 ~13.35 miles northeast of Palmyra
  • Has swimming pool: Indoor Pool Open 6am - 11pm
  • Affordable Downtown property
From$80
Very Good 4.0 /5 Review Score Call BookMore Details
Town & Country Inn and Suites
+1-800-805-5223
110 North 54th St., Quincy, IL 62305 +1-800-805-5223 ~13.70 miles northeast of Palmyra
  • We have a pool
  • Cheap Highway hotel
From$104
Very Good 4.0 /5 Guest Reviews Call BookMore Details
Hampton Inn Keokuk - Keokuk
+1-888-965-1860
3201 Main St., Keokuk, IA 52632 +1-888-965-1860 ~43.15 miles north of Palmyra
  • Pool available: Indoor heated pool. 7am-11pm
  • 3 star Downtown hotel
From$61
Very Good 4.0 /5 Review Score Call BookMore Details
Back to Top